Icebreaker Toolkit: Simple Openers That Get Replies
If you worry about sounding boring or starting with a cringey line, start simple and specific. Pick one clear detail from their profile and turn it into a low-pressure question or short observation you could actually imagine saying in person.
- Profile-based hook: "You mentioned hiking—what trail would you recommend for someone who likes views more than bugs?" Adapt by swapping any activity, book, or band you see.
- Routine-friendly opener: "Quick poll: coffee, tea, or something else to survive a Monday?" Use this style to invite a light preference rather than a deep biography.
- Fun micro-challenge: "Two truths and one lie about me: I’ve met a celeb, I can juggle, I once got lost in a castle. Your turn?" Keep it playful and easy to answer.
- Callback-style message: If they mention a travel photo or a hobby, follow up later with a short callback: "Still thinking about that sea kayaking photo—what was the best part?" It shows you remembered and keeps the conversation personal.
- Friendly observation + question: "Love your playlist shoutout—what song are you playing on repeat this week?" Observations are better than generic compliments because they invite specifics.
Avoid these common traps: don’t start with a one-word greeting, avoid forced compliments like "You're so beautiful" with no context, and skip overly intense questions like "Where do you see yourself in five years?" too early. If you want to reuse an opener, personalize one detail each time so messages don’t read like copy-paste.
Short tips to keep in mind: keep messages under three sentences, end with an easy question or a clear invitation to reply, and match their tone—if they’re casual, be casual. If you get a brief answer, respond with a follow-up that adds something new instead of turning it into an interrogation.
